Ce projet vise à optimiser le référencement (SEO) et l'accessilité du site de la photographe Nina Carducci, spécialisée dans les portraits et les événements. L'objectif est d'améliorer les performances du site, sa structure de code, et son accessibilité afin d'obtenir un meilleur classement dans les moteurs de recherche. Ce projet est réalisé dans le cadre du parcours de formation Intégrateur Web d'OpenClassrooms.
- [Objectifs]#(objectifs)
- [Etapes]#(étapes)
- [livrables]#(livrables)
- [OutilsUtilisés]#(Outils utilisés)
- [InstructionsPourDéveloppeurs]#(Instructions pour développeurs)
- [Contributeurs]#(Contributeurs)
- [Licence]#(licence)
- Identifier les problèmes de chargement et de référencement du site.
- Proposer des recommandations pour améliorer la vitesse de chargement, la structure du code, et le référencement.
- Appliquer les améliorations proposées.
- Créer un rapport illustrant les résutats avant et après les modifictaions.
-
Analyse initiale :
- Réaliser un audit avec Lighthouse et GTMetrix.
- Identifier les principaux axes d'améliorations.
-
Optimisation des performances :
- Optimiser les images du site.
- Minifier les fichiers HTML, CSS, et Javascript.
- Améliorer la structure du code.
-
Optimisation SEO :
- Utiliser des balises sémantiques HTML.
- Ajouter des metas pour les réseaux sociaux (OpenGraph, Twitter Cards...).
- Mettre en place le référencement local avec Schema.org.
-
Amélioration de l'accessibilité :
- Utiliser l'extension Wawe Evaluation Tool pour vérifier l'accessibilité.
- Corriger les problèmes d'accessibilité identifiés.
-
Rapport d'optimisation :
- Documenter les modifications apportées et leur impact.
- Inclure des captures d'écrans des audits avant et après les modifications
- Code source optimisé.
- Rapport d'optimisations au format PDF.
- Captures d'écran des audits Lighthouse, Rich Snippets, et Wawe.
- Documentation de Lighthouse : Lighthouse
- Documentation de GTMetric : GTMetrix
- Documentation de WAWE : WAVE Evaluation Tool
- HTML
- CSS
- Bootstrap
- Javascript
- Jquery
Pour installer et éxécuter ce projet localement, suivez les étapes ci-dessous:
git clone https://github.com/adelbonn/Nina_Carducci_P8_OC.git
cd Nina_Carducci_P8_OC
- Installer Live Server en tant qu'extension de votre IDE
- Ouvrir le fichier index.html avec LiveServer
-Adeline Bonnamour - Intégrateur Web
Ce projet est sous licence MIT Voir le fichier Licence pour plus de détails